New Indian Cuisine Cookbook Brings Ancient Ayurvedic Wisdom to the Dining Table

New book from Bina Mehta, Turmeric & Spice: Indian Cuisine for the Mind, Body and Spirit, delivers on the promise of healthy, wholesome eating.

DENVER - Sept. 5, 2019 - PRLog -- The Ayurvedic healing traditions in India date back thousands of years. Through the strategic use of herbs, spices, fruits, and vegetables in the preparation of delicious meals, Ayurvedic chefs have been improving the lives of millions throughout the world.

Today, certified Ayurvedic Lifestyle Consultant Bina Mehta is making available her new book, Turmeric & Spice: Indian Cuisine for the Mind, Body and Spirit, free on Amazon Kindle, but only for four days. This is an excellent opportunity for anyone curious about the healing power of Ayurvedic food to learn more about these fascinating culinary techniques.

The color paperback version of the book is also available at Amazon ($34.99).

Topics covered in this beautiful new cookbook include:
  • When and how to use spices to "unlock" the taste of food
  • Balancing the gut biome with fermented ingredients
  • Which kitchen equipment essentials are needed for Indian cooking
  • Multiple step-by-step recipes for traditional Indian meals hailing from cities, such as Mumbai (Bombay street food), and regions such as Gujarat, South India, and North India.
  • An entire chapter dedicated solely to chutneys
